Tunnel containers are also referred to as double door shipping containers. They have the same dimensions as standard ISO container, but the difference is that they open at both ends. This allows for quick access to the cargo and is useful when you are using the container for storage or conversion project.

Tunnel containers can be used for a variety of different purposes. The dual entry points provide easy access to equipment and materials from both ends which makes it easier for palletised goods to be moved using forklifts, and makes the management of stock flow simpler. Tunnel containers are typically used as temporary bridges on construction sites, and as ticket entrances to festivals and other events.
They are also an excellent solution for self storage. By constructing a steel bulkhead, a 20ft container can be divided into two 10ft units. This increases the return on investment. Tunnel containers can be modified in a variety of ways, including lighting inside, as well as side windows, making them more suitable for businesses.
The double doors at both ends of the container also make it perfect for storing large or bulky items. This is particularly useful in warehouses, as it can be difficult to fit large equipment and vehicles in standard shipping containers. It will save you a huge amount of time as you don't have to constantly reposition the container which allows you to keep moving goods throughout the day.
Tunnel containers can be fitted with cooling and heating systems, which allows them to be used for temperature-controlled storage of products such as food, chemicals, pharmaceuticals and electronics. They can also be equipped with ventilation systems to prevent condensation in the goods.
Tunnel containers are available in 20ft tunnel containers or 40ft tunnel container sizes, the same as standard shipping containers. They meet ISO shipping standards as well as being CSC plated for international freight and can be made weatherproof with the addition of insulation.

Double-end door containers, or Tunnel Containers as they are popularly referred to, give access to the items stored from both sides of the container. This makes it easier to gain access to load and unloading, and allows for full utilisation of storage space. These units are ideal for self-storage facilities as they allow access to both sides without the need to take items off. This is especially beneficial for those who need to store massive, bulky or awkward items such as machinery and heavy equipment.
In addition to this the tunnel container's design permits these units to be easily converted into offices or other storage spaces that are secure. Tunnel containers, unlike open side shipping containers can be opened from either end with the doors locked again. This allows them to be used for the construction of on-site offices, or even housing, if needed.

Logistics professionals employ different terms to describe the way cargo is prepared for transport and then moved along a supply chain. These terms include container stuffing and de-stuffing. These terms refer to the process by which goods are taken out of or loaded into containers for shipping. Understanding these concepts will assist any business that uses shipping containers for storage or distribution to succeed.
Stuffing a tunnel container is carefully placing cargo in order to maximize space and meet the specific requirements of logistics. Depending on the nature of the cargo, specific packing and loading techniques must be used to prevent damage during transit. It is important to place the bulkiest cargo on the bottom, and place lighter items on top. Additionally it is crucial to take appropriate measures of security to stop the cargo from shifting in transit. Optimizing the container load helps reduce handling, shipping and labor costs, and also ensures compliance with the regulations for safe transport.
Container de-stuffing, or unloading is a crucial step to ensure the effectiveness of your supply chain. This process removes any excess freight from a shipping container, and requires careful inspection to identify any signs of water damage, or other physical damage that could threaten the integrity of the cargo. De-stuffing is only feasible when the logistics company and shipper communicate effectively and adhere to all applicable regulations.

Despite being constructed of steel, container cargo loads are still vulnerable to theft. The methods used by thieves have evolved and they're capable of breaking into a steel container by removing the doors or hinges. Therefore, it's crucial for businesses to put in place measures to prevent their containers from being taken.
One way to accomplish this is to install a lockbox on the doors. They are welded steel shrouds that fit over the lug of the container door which holds the padlock. They make it difficult to access the area of the padlock using bolt cutters. Additionally, businesses can install an alarm that is high-security and will alert them if someone attempts to cut the lockbox.
